Throttle SELECT-based scrubbing to seek the underlying frame ~every 150ms instead of waiting 1s after pan-end, so the visible frame keeps up with the scrub handle. Hide the redundant storyboard panel during live scrub (the frame itself is now the preview) but keep the chapter capsule visible. Storyboard panel still shown for D-pad arrow-seek where the frame doesn't move until commit. Auto-commit scrub mode after 3s of inactivity, matching AVPlayerViewController behavior — playback resumes via the existing scrub-pause wiring instead of staying paused indefinitely.
